This week I have the absolute pleasure of being joined by pediatric eating expert Jessica Setnick ( MS,RD, CEDRD-S).
Jessica is one of my favourite guests to have had on the show.
We are talking everything to do with eating disorders in children;
How it can start, how you can tell there are issues and how to start resolving it.
Basically this is all about how you can help your child have a healthy relationship with food, regardless of whether they currently have one or not.
This is an absolutely essential conversation for every parent to be aware of as pediatric eating disorders are extremely common and, quite often, preventable/fixable with a bit of work (to be fair, sometimes a lot of work).
